strip prefix of temporary file names when it exceeds filesystem name length limit When doing lto, rustc generates filenames that are concatenating many information. In the case of this testcase, it is concatenating crate name and rust file name, plus some hash, and the extension. In some other cases it will concatenate even more information reducing the maximum effective crate name to about 110 chars on linux filesystems where filename max length is 255 This commit is ensuring that the temporary file names are limited in size, while still reasonably ensuring the unicity (with hashing of the stripped part) Fix: rust-lang/rust#49914
